Output 51ca916cc9b7f4bd94a6159d1d70de6e7ab0a831ad0c58e7be75f523b2300977:0

value
8343071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cb45f377ab67b87e1070fceb1743daa6264d3c OP_EQUAL
address
3MjBRE98UsowAMj6m5AyBLr3iLTGHRCHuU
transaction
51ca916cc9b7f4bd94a6159d1d70de6e7ab0a831ad0c58e7be75f523b2300977
spent
true